Sažetak
Polysaccharides in currently used vaccines are mostly week immunogens. To improve their immunogenicity conjugates of covalently coupled polysaccharides to protein carriers are being developed. Our approach is different: we are trying to prepare a conjugate by coupling the small immunomodulatory molecule - N-tert-butyloxycarbonyl-L-tyrosyl-peptidoglycan monomer (BocTyrPGM) (1) to polysaccharides of interest, assuming that its immunoadjuvant properties could improve the response to a polysaccharide part of the molecule.
The aim of present work was to prepare the conjugates of polysaccharides and BocTyrPGM which could be further tested in various experimental models and their immunogenic properties assesed.
We have used as polyssacharide antigens the water-soluble dextran FP 70, (Mw 70 kDa) and the major capsular polysaccharide from the fungus Cryptococcus neoformans var. gatii, glucuronoxylomannan (GXM), serotype B (Mw 700 kDa) (2). The native form of GXM is insoluble in water, so we reduced its size by ultrasonic irradiation, and separated water-soluble fragments of approx. 80 kDa on the Sepharose 4FF column. Both sugars were derivatized by coupling the adipic acid dihydrazide (ADH) to respective polysaccharides activated with cyanogen bromide. The AH-sugar derivatives were separated from the reaction mixture on the Sephadex G25 column and their sugar and ADH contents were analysed by the phenol-sulfuric and picryl-sulfonic acid method, respectively. The peptide bonds were subsequently formed between -NH2 groups of the AH-sugar derivatives and -COOH group of the BocTyrPGM in the presence of N-ethyl-N-(3-dimethylaminopropyl)-carbodiimid-hydrochloride. The conjugates formed were separated from the reaction mixture by chromatography on the Sephadex G25 column and characterized with respect to their sugar and peptide content.
